[ ] Ceremony step 4 — AddressPilot widget signing

Reviewer: before approving, confirm that the AddressPilot autocomplete widget bundle was built from the tagged release, that the checksum matches the ceremony record, and that both custodians initialed the log. The signing module will remain sealed until the final verification passes, at which point it must be unsealed with the passphrase below.

unlock words, yawig-kagef: gordor-holvan-ulaael-pramir-ulaiel-tamdor

Decision: 12% price increase for legacy Corvette-tier customers on the Fennwright platform, effective next renewal cycle. Churn modelling by the Aldermoor team projects 4–6% attrition, within tolerance. Revenue uplift estimated at a net positive even at the high churn case. Heads of department should brief account managers but hold external comms until the notice letters are approved. Grandfathering requests route to the pricing committee; no ad-hoc exceptions. Context on the wider plan appears in the confidential note directly below.

management briefing: Gross margin on Ralael came in at 15 percent against a plan of 10 percent. Only 9 of the 100 pilot accounts renewed Ralael, so a churn review is set for April 1.

When reviewing changes to the Tidemarsh API's pooling layer, confirm that the pool size, idle timeout, and acquisition timeout have been adjusted together — changing one in isolation has caused connection storms twice before. The pool fronts a single primary; replicas are read-only and use a separate, smaller pool. Any increase to max connections must be matched by a corresponding change on the database side, coordinated with the data team. Verify the proposed change against the current production values shown here.

deployment values, kajep-kageg:
[praix]
host = praix.paliqcorp.corp
user = praix_svc
database = praix_prod